Output e4ec3a83e27a01cd3ba39afc1c7fe2f5c7608c334f971e136ff684ce9f41cbd2:1

value
23798869641
script pubkey
OP_0 OP_PUSHBYTES_20 905ec926a0c796486e0e7dffbf243b962bd00561
address
bc1qjp0vjf4qc7tysmsw0hlm7fpmjc4aqptprevx5w
transaction
e4ec3a83e27a01cd3ba39afc1c7fe2f5c7608c334f971e136ff684ce9f41cbd2